Increased absolute concentrations of intracellular NAD + links with activation of NAD + -dependent histone deacetylases (e.g., sirtuins) that also mediate epigenetic regulation of gene expression[40] and adipocyte physiology.[45] Similarly, increased intracellular concentrations of SAM, a universal substrate for SAM-dependent histone methyltransferases, could have profound influence on cellular epigenetic modifications, including transcriptional regulation and the expression of genes that regulate adipogenesis and/or thermogenesis promoting browning of adipocytes (e.g., PPAR, PRDM16, UCP1, Wnt).[4648] NNMT protein expression is relatively lower in the murine brown adipose tissue (BAT) compared to the WAT [37] and nnmt (a WAT-selective gene [49, 50]) gene expression has been reported to be lower in the BAT of HFD fed mice compared to normal chow-fed mice.[49] Furthermore, NNMT activity is significantly higher in the white fat compared to brown adipose tissue and the other organs (e.g., liver, lungs) in DIO mice.[16] Hence, treatment with an NNMT inhibitor in DIO mice may less likely impact BAT or other tissue NNMT activity, but could be speculated to modulate thermogenic/adipogenic genes in the WAT
